WebAug 24, 2024 · RC Circuit Principle (Reference: electronics-tutorials.ws) Assume that the capacitor, C, has been totally “discharged” and that the switch, S, is fully open. These are the circuit’s initial conditions, then t = 0, I = 0, and q = 0. When the switch is closed, time starts at t = 0, and current flows into the capacitor through the resistor. dobbs ferry gisWebCalculate the RC time constant, τ of the following circuit. The time constant, τ is found using the formula T = R x C in seconds.
